The following information is based on the U.S. Department of Education data. We note that data for the school is not available since 2016 (the school has been closed, excluded from the IPEDS database and/or the school did not reported its data). You may want to check the information for reference or research purposes. It is a four-years, private (not-for-profit) school located in W Bloomfield, MI. It is classified as by Carnegie Classification and its highest level of offering is Un-Known. The tuition & fees in the last active year are $3,980. 94% of enrolled students have received grants or scholarships and the average aid amount is $4,975 at Michigan Jewish Institute. The school had a total enrollment of 996 and the student to faculty ratio was 17 to 1.

Tuition & Fees

For undergraduate school, its tuition and fees were $3,980. Total 996 students were attending at the school and it did not possess campus housing facilities (i.e. dormitory and residence halls possessed by the school).

Key Statistics

The Acceptance rate at Michigan Jewish Institute was 66% and the yield (enrollment rate) was 91%. Key academic stats for the school were listed in The following table.
